#240d93 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#240d93 is composed of 14.1% red, 5.1%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.5% cyan, 91.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 250.3 degrees, a saturation of 83.8% and a lightness of 31.4%. #240d93 color hex could be obtained by blending #481aff with #000027.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#240d93 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#240d93 has RGB values of R:36, G:13, B:147 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0.91,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 2362771.

Shades and Tints of #240d93
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010003 is the darkest color, while #f2f0f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#240d93
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c4b55 is the less saturated color, while #1c019f is the most saturated one.
